Noob question 727 really low shift points

I'd be surprised if I found a shop that knew what it was (or wasn't):D
If you do a Google search you can find lots of images showing what used to be there.

I would get under that thing, or look down there with a flashlight and see if it's got the lever and what is or isn't there and take it from there.
On the trans, there should be a lever like this fingers pointing at.
Some had a knobbed stud like this and some have a hole the end of a rod goes into.
In any case, this is the throttle pressure control.

View attachment 1715095537

Ok, I'll definitely be under there this evening. One way or another I'll have an idea about this before tomorrow.